Authoritative guidance on maintaining clean ventilation systems — HVCA’s TR/19.
A guide to the internal cleanliness of ventilation systems developed by the HVCA is expected to become invaluable for those working with ventilation systems and vital when proving standards for insurance purposes. TR/19 is designed for use by specifiers, consultants and building legislators to ensure that ventilation systems are properly maintained. It is especially important for kitchen ventilation because of the elevated risk of grease deposits, which can cause fires. Adherence to the standards in TR/19 will provide detailed, recognised proof that the ventilation system in a building is safe and well maintained, which is vital for securing insurance policies.
